Dow and Plastics Institute of Thailand donate 1,740 Thai Kit Spacers to hospital

Thai Kit Spacer donationBangkok – May 13, 2020 – After donating 3,200 PPE suits to 8 hospitals, Dow Thailand has recently joined hands with Plastics Institute of Thailand in the donation of 1,740 Thai Kit Spacers, which will be used to treat patients with respiratory illness during the outbreak of COVID-19, to Thammasat University Hospital.

Designed and developed by Plastics Institute of Thailand and the hospital as a substitute for imported equipment, the Thai Kit Spacer helps reduce the risk of droplets spreading while patients are receiving the medical spray. This can enhance safety of frontline health workers. The donated spacers will be further distributed to more than 500 hospitals in need across the nation.

About Dow
Dow (NYSE: DOW) combines global breadth, asset integration and scale, focused innovation and leading business positions to achieve profitable growth. The Company’s ambition is to become the most innovative, customer centric, inclusive and sustainable materials science company. Dow’s portfolio of plastics, industrial intermediates, coatings and silicones businesses delivers a broad range of differentiated science-based products and solutions for its customers in high-growth market segments, such as packaging, infrastructure, automotive and consumer care. Dow operates 109 manufacturing sites in 31 countries and employs approximately 36,500 people. Dow delivered sales of approximately $43 billion in 2019.
